A Will to Lead: Generous estate gift from Elon alumnus Wayne T. Moore ’49 endows professorship
December 14, 2023
The professorship established by the late Elon alumnus and faculty member Wayne T. Moore ’49 and his wife, Elizabeth, will support the teaching and research of an emerging scholar in the arts, humanities or social sciences. The $500,000 gift honors Wayne's late brother, Fletcher Moore '34, a longtime music faculty member at Elon.

Special musical piece to honor 1923 commemoration, Whitley Auditorium performed on Oct. 8
October 4, 2023
Associate Professor of Music Todd Coleman received a request from the Office of Cultural & Special Programs to commission a musical piece commemorating the 1923 fire and the 100th anniversary of the laying of the cornerstone for Whitley Auditorium. The debut performance of the piece will be held on Sunday, Oct. 8 at 3 p.m. in Whitley.
